Why Choose Energy-Efficient Heating?

 

Energy-efficient heating units are designed to maximize heat output while minimizing energy consumption. Here’s why upgrading to one of these systems is a smart choice:

   •       Lower Utility Bills: Modern systems use advanced technology to reduce energy waste, cutting down on monthly heating costs.

   •       Environmentally Friendly: Efficient systems produce fewer greenhouse gas emissions, helping to reduce your carbon footprint.

   •       Improved Home Comfort: These systems distribute heat more evenly, keeping every corner of your home cozy.

   •       Tax Credits and Incentives: Many energy-efficient models qualify for government rebates and tax credits, making them more affordable.

 

Top Energy-Efficient Heating Systems in 2025

 

If you’re ready to make the switch, consider these popular and highly efficient heating options:

 

1. Heat Pumps

 

Heat pumps are among the most energy-efficient heating solutions available today. They work by transferring heat from the air or ground into your home, requiring less energy than traditional furnaces.

   •       Best For: Mild to moderate climates.

   •       Energy Savings: Up to 50% compared to electric or gas furnaces.

 

2. High-Efficiency Gas Furnaces

 

Gas furnaces have come a long way, with modern models boasting AFUE (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ency) ratings of 90% or higher. This means they convert most of the fuel they consume into usable heat.

   •       Best For: Homes with existing gas lines.

   •       Energy Savings: Significant reduction in fuel usage compared to older models.

 

3. Radiant Floor Heating

 

Radiant heating systems use hot water or electric coils beneath your flooring to warm your home. They’re not only efficient but also incredibly comfortable.

   •       Best For: New builds or renovations.

   •       Energy Savings: Can reduce energy use by 15–30% compared to traditional heating.

 

4. Ductless Mini-Split Systems

 

These systems allow you to heat specific zones in your home without the energy loss associated with ductwork. Mini-splits are perfect for homes without central heating systems.

   •       Best For: Homes with additions or rooms that are difficult to heat.

   •       Energy Savings: Up to 30% compared to traditional HVAC systems.

 

How to Choose the Right Heating System

 

Selecting the perfect heating system for your home depends on several factors, including:

   •       Climate: Certain systems perform better in specific climates.

   •       Home Size: Larger homes may require more powerful systems.

   •       Budget: Consider both upfront costs and long-term savings.

   •       Existing Infrastructure: Retrofitting costs may influence your decision.
